A professional services firm in Crawley is seeking an experienced project manager to oversee critical projects. This role involves managing project delivery, engaging with technical and non-technical stakeholders, and leading ERP implementations.
A minimum of 5 years' experience in project management, excellent communication skills, and a Bachelor's degree in a related field are required. Strong knowledge of ITIL and project management methodologies is essential.
Competitive compensation and opportunities for professional growth are offered.
